About Alexander Elliot

Alexander Elliot (born December 8, 2004) is a Canadian actor. He is known for starring as Joe Hardy on the 2020 television series adaptation The Hardy Boys, opposite Rohan Campbell as Frank. Elliot is from Toronto. He began acting and dancing at six. He has appeared on the series Detention Adventure, Odd Squad, and Locke & Key, and the films Trapped: The Alex Cooper Story and Violent Night.
